Installed 2nd Optical Drive But Windows 10 Doesn't See It.

I finally got around to installing a second optical (DVD) drive in my XPS8700 system. I connected it to the SATA2. The OS is Windows 10 Pro.

I have installed new drives into systems before with no problems. I.E., install it, turn it on, and away we go. Now however, it didn’t work that way. The door opens and closes, but the system doesn’t see it. Is there something I have to do with Windows 10 Pro, that I never had to do with other windows versions?

It looks like the optical drive is receiving power but the Data cable may be not be functional. I would suggest you to swap the data cables or slots to check if the new optical drive detects in the BIOS.

Since posting the above, I checked the bios and the new drive is not in the bios.

Yesterday I opened the system for a couple of reasons. I found that the data cable was not seated properly on the drive itself. Works fine now.
